Exploring Transfer Options from Nice Airport

Upon landing at Nice Côte d’Azur Airport, travelers are greeted with a variety of transfer options to suit different preferences and budgets. Public transportation is a popular choice for those looking to save money, with buses and trams providing regular services to various parts of the city and surrounding areas. The Lignes d’Azur network operates several routes from the airport, including the popular tram line 2, which connects the airport to the city center in a matter of minutes. For those seeking a more direct and comfortable ride, taxis are readily available outside the terminals, offering door-to-door service to your hotel or accommodation.

Private transfer services present another viable option for those who prioritize convenience and a personalized experience. Companies like Uber and local private hire firms offer pre-booked rides that can be arranged online before your arrival, ensuring a stress-free transition from the airport. Additionally, car rentals can be a practical choice for travelers planning to explore the broader region at their own pace. With several reputable car hire companies located within the airport premises, visitors have the flexibility to embark on their Riviera journey immediately upon arrival.

Comparing Costs and Convenience of Transfers

When it comes to cost, public transportation stands out as the most economical option for airport transfers. A single bus or tram ticket costs just a few euros, making it an attractive choice for budget-conscious travelers. However, the trade-off for lower costs is often a longer travel time and potential inconvenience, especially if you are carrying heavy luggage or traveling during peak hours when public transport can be crowded. Taxis, on the other hand, provide a more expensive but faster and more comfortable alternative, with fares to the city center typically ranging from 30 to 50 euros, depending on traffic and time of day.

Private transfers and car rentals cater to those who value convenience over cost. While these options can be significantly more expensive than public transport, they offer the advantage of flexibility and a personalized travel experience. Private transfers are particularly beneficial for families or groups, as the cost can be split among passengers, making it a more economical option than taxis in some cases. Similarly, car rentals provide the freedom to explore the region at your leisure, although it’s important to factor in additional costs such as fuel and parking fees.
